Will a 350 fuel injection fit on a 305?

I was wondering if I could put a 350 fuel injection on my 305? Then I was wondering if it would give me more power and would I have to change other stuff besides the computer?

are you talking about fuel injectors?? if so, yes you can put 350 fuel injectors on a 305. the difference is that the 350 uses 22lb injectors and the 305 uses 19lb injectors. only do this if you need more fuel, if you have a basically stock 305 engine you dont need the 22lbers.

The TPI hardware, wire harness, and computer are identical for 305 and 350. The only difference is the injectors, and the PROM.

Chris,
I think there is some confusion here. You have a 305, right? Which injection system do you have? If you have TBI, it is a little more difficult to put TPI on it. Depending on the year, the wiring, computer, and fuel pump will be different. If you have TPI already, it's the same as the 350, just different injectors (and program).
